The Arkham Company has a ratio of long-term debt to long-term debt plus equity of .42 and a current ratio of 1.4. Current liabilities are $980, sales are $6,400, profit margin is 9.5 percent, and ROE is 20.3 percent. What is the amount of the firm’s net fixed assets? (Do not round intermediate calculations and round your answer to 2 decimal places, e.g., 32.16.)
Net fixed assets $____________
